The Colorful World of Sedimentary Sandstone
Sedimentary sandstone arises through a fascinating geological process. Over vast stretches of duration, tiny grains of minerals are moved by wind and ultimately deposited in layers. As these deposits build, they compact under the weight of subsequent layers, forming sandstone rocks. The distinctive colors of sandstone stem from the presence of different minerals within the sediment. Iron oxides, for illustration, produce hues of brown.

Geological Processes Shaping Sandstone Formations
Sandstone formations emerge from a captivating interplay of geological processes spanning millions of years. Sedimentation is the initial step, where particles of sand are transported by forces such as wind, water, or ice and accumulated in a setting. Over time, these layers of sediment become solidified under the burden of overlying layers. Cementation then takes place, where minerals dissolved in groundwater precipitate between the particles, cementing them together into a cohesive rock.
Erosion can alter existing sandstone formations, creating dramatic landforms. The interplay of these processes, constantly changing, gives rise to the varied and magnificent sandstone formations we observe today.
